Price Observation Bias

Observation

The Price Observation Bias, particularly acute within cryptocurrency derivatives and options markets, stems from the inherent limitations in how market participants perceive and interpret price data. Observed prices are not a direct reflection of underlying asset value but rather a consequence of order flow, liquidity conditions, and the actions of other traders. This bias manifests as a tendency to overweight recent price movements or perceived patterns, potentially leading to suboptimal trading decisions and inaccurate risk assessments, especially when dealing with volatile assets like cryptocurrencies.
